An elegant, almost dry style, with cardamom, melon and honeysuckle notes. Features lively acidity that provides balance and support, keeping this focused from the start to the long finish. Fenugreek accents linger. Drink now through 2028. 127 cases...

A Pinot noir made from manually-harvested grapes which undergo a spontaneous fermentation in open wooden barrels. The malolactic fermentation takes place in barrique. This Pinot displays a deep red fruity flavour with a complex character; fine and...
